Cherry 2000

  • Log in or register to post comments

In a not-so-distant future, where technology has advanced by leaps and bounds, love has become digital. A man named Sam Treadwell has everything he could desire: a stable job, a cozy home, and, above all, a perfect robotic girlfriend named Cherry. However, his life takes an unexpected turn when, after a strange accident, his beloved companion model breaks down. Desperate to regain his ideal love, Sam embarks on a dangerous mission to a post-apocalyptic world that has become a technological wasteland, filled with dangers and gangs.

In his quest, he encounters a strong and independent survivor named E. V. Marv, who has her own problems but also hides a spark of excitement in a very gray world. Together, they must face a path full of obstacles, from ruthless mercenaries to the ruins of a society that has prioritized pleasure over reality. As the adventure unfolds, Sam begins to question what love truly means and what he is willing to risk for an authentic connection.

With touches of action, humor, and a sci-fi twist, the film serves as both a critique and a reflection on relationships in the digital age. Will Sam be able to find his Cherry again, or will he discover that true love goes beyond what is programmed?
